I've been using a pair of these DMX colour blaster for a couple of years and find them to be very tough, reliable, effective and easy to use. They have a lens to focus for a narrow spot, although as most of my work is in small venues, removing the lens makes for a much wider beam. They work as a master slave arrangement via a dmx lead. They run a factory pre-set sequence of colours, strobing and dimming. A useful feature is they can be easily switched via dip switches at the front to show just continuous white, ideal to illuminate the band that never bring any of there own lights! Or on to a mirror ball.

Running directly from a switch panel bulb life has been reduced as I had no way of switching them off via DMX, therefore the cooling fans stop. Bulbs are not expensive and very easy to change.

I've just bought a controller from Chris which i'm slowly understanding how to program for my own show!

The only drawback is they are heavy.
